A time-lapse view of a week’s work on the new Apple store

Here’s a time-lapse image for a week’s work late last year (Nov. 28 to Dec. 2) on the new $27 million Apple store by the Chicago River on Michigan Ave., being built to designs by Norman Foster of Foster + Partners.

In this video by Eric Stein, the foundation is just about completed and the stairways both exterior and interior are taking form. He recorded the time-lapse video from across the street on the 30th floor.

Photos taken using Canon T3i with Tamron wide-angle lens, 1 frame per minute: a 1500x speedup timelapse. Photos taken in aperture priority mode. Photos shot continuously between Nov 28 2016 at 12:30 Central Time and Dec 2 2016 at 18:46 Central Time.
